The bus stops either side of Thimble End Road (aka Walmley By-pass) near Springfield Road are still there and showing Not in Use, last time I looked.  They were on the dog-leg on the old 68A/C route before buses started going straight down the Walmley Road.

The other interesting anomaly locally is the pair of bus stops at the top end of Rectory Road near the junction with Coleshill Road (back of Holy Trinity Church).  These have been signed "not in use" since the demise of Rotala's 119 Falcon Lodge service.  But nowadays, the 110 and the 904 (one way) both pass them.  So are they back in use or not?  I'll have to try getting off there one day!

And, as far as I'm aware, the service numbers on the bus stops in Riland Road still show 110 and 904 despite the re-routing ....
